### Runbook: BounceBroom — Account Recovery

If the BounceBroom email bounce processor loses access to its service account, do not create a new one. First, pause the intake queue so bounces buffer safely. Then open the recovery console and select the BounceBroom principal. Verification requires approval from the on-call lead. Once approved, the console prompts for the stored recovery credentials; enter the passphrase that appears directly below this paragraph.

recovery phrase for fahof-kahap: holion-gormir-jorix-istix-briwyn-sorael

Action item 4 (owner: Priya on the Tallowgate team): the incident showed that Fernwheel's template renderer recompiles partials on every request when the cache key includes the locale hash, causing p99 latency to triple during the Veldmont launch. We will pin compiled templates in a bounded LRU and precompile the top locales at deploy time. Release manager sign-off required before the next train. The proposed cache sizing and eviction constants for review are listed here.

tuning constants:
QUOTAS = {
    "quenael": 10,
    "oliwyn": 1,
}

Capacity note for on-call: the Ledgerline report builder switched to a stable merge sort for grouped exports, which roughly doubles memory on wide reports. Expect pressure on the render workers above 200k rows; the fallback external sort kicks in past the spill threshold and is slow but safe. Don't raise worker counts without checking disk on the spill volume. Current tuning for the sort stage is as follows:

tuning constants:
TIERS = {
    "sorion": 670,
    "istax": 547,
}